The latest release from Intrada is the first ever score CD release of one of Michael Giacchino's first feature scores, the 2005 superhero comedy adventure SKY HIGH, starring Michael Angarano, Kelly Preston and Kurt Russell.


Music Box is releasing an expanded version of Georges Delerue's typically beautiful score for the 1988 period romance A SUMMER STORY, starring James Wilby and Imogen Stubbs.


This month, along with their previously announced expansion of Mark Mancina's Twister, La La Land plans to release the score for the documentary AN ACT OF LOVE, composed by animation veterans Lolita Ritmanis, Michael McCuistion and Kristopher Carter, and a two-disc expanded/remastered version of Trevor Jones' CLIFFHANGER.


The British Academy of Film and Television Arts announced this year's nomination for their film awards, including Original Music:

ARRIVAL - Jóhann Jóhannsson
JACKIE - Mica Levi
LA LA LAND - Justin Hurwitz
LION - Dustin O'Halloran, Hauschka
NOCTURNAL ANIMALS - Abel Korzeniowski

Justin Hurwitz and La La Land won the Golden Globes for original score and original song ("City of Stars," lyrics by Benj Pasek and Justin Paul).

DID THEY MENTION THE MUSIC?

THE ASSASSIN - Lim Giong
 
"Mood is key here, because though 'The Assassin' has just about everything a viewer would expect in a martial-arts fantasy (outrageous fake beards, wire-assisted leaps, black magic, etc.), it’s all muted and subsumed by a poetic atmosphere that’s radical even by Hou’s standards. At once ravishingly lush and starkly minimalist, shot almost entirely in boxy Academy ratio and scored to martial drums and birdsong, the movie seems to come from no time except the one it’s invented for itself."
 
Ignatiy Vishnevetsky, The Onion AV Club

"Extreme wide shots place the characters against stunning mountain terrains and inside wild forests, recalling the crystalline detail of classical Chinese paintings; interior scenes unfold in a golden glow, gauzy curtains drifting back and forth over the action, while crickets chirp and tribal drums sound periodically, the hushed tone making the eruptions of swordplay seem even more clangorous. The dazzling 35-millimeter photography is by Mark Lee Ping Bing."
 
J.R. Jones, Chicago Reader

"The score by Giong Lim ('A Touch of Sin') remains spare and period-sounding -- except for one action scene in which it suddenly takes a turn into 1980s action-movie synth territory -- and the spare, precise editing from Liao Ching-Sung and Huang Chih-Chia balances Hou’s long takes and the relatively fast-paced action moments with graceful skill."
 
Alonso Duralde, The Wrap
 
"Lim Giong’s score, making use of menacing drumbeats and delicate zither strumming, is deployed with particular subtlety."
 
Justin Chang, Variety

"Among the film’s superlative tech work, major credit goes to production and costume designer Hwarng Wern-ying and composer Lim Giong for a highly original use of music, drumbeats and other effects to convey an unsettling modern mood."
 
Deborah Young, Hollywood Reporter
